Cipher'in' Letters Protect your online communications and other aspect of your life on the internet GnuPG and OpenPGP for everybody Stéphane 22Decembre Guedon version base 1 of the 3th july 2015 Chapter 1 Preamble This document uses my texts from my GPG-Howto or tutorial. It is the short version, with the functions that I think are the most important in GnuPG and OpenPG. This How-to can be read on my website1. I wish you read, share and reshare this work, online (html) or o-line (this pdf). Of course, the texts have been slightly modied to correspond to their current form: a mini-book. But I kept the exercises from the blog articles. The aim of this document is to push internet users, so actually some big part of the occidental population, to protect their communications in the form of mails and instant messaging. As I am writing this book, some laws, extremely dangerous for privacy and public liberties, are being voted or adopted by several european countries. One of the biggest difficulties in migrating from Windows to Linux is the lack of knowledge about comparable software. Newbies usually search for Linux analogs of Windows software, and advanced Linux-users cannot answer their questions since they often don't know too much about Windows :). This list of Linux equivalents / replacements / analogs of Windows software is based on our own experience and on the information obtained from the visitors of this page (thanks!). This table is not static since new application names can be added to both left and the right sides. Also, the right column for a particular class of applications may not be filled immediately.
